A field experiment was conducted at the farmer’s field in Sherpur district under Regional Agricultural Research station, Bangladesh Agricultural Research Institute (BARI), Jamalpur, during Kharif season from 19 April 2008 to 25 February, 2009 and 19 April 2009 to 25 February 2010 to find out suitable combination of fertilizers and manure for maximizing the yield of turmeric. Seven packages of fertilizers in combination with manure (F1 = Control, F2 = Soil test base (STB): N130P40K130S15Zn2, F3 = 50%, STB + 5 ton cowdung/ha, F4 = FRG-2005: N120P30K100S15Zn3 kg/ha +3 ton cowdung/ha, F5 = 75% FRG-2005+5 ton cowdung/ha, F6 = 10 ton cowdung/ha, F7 = Farmer’s practice: N50P20K40+ 5 ton cowdung/ha) were used in the experiment. A randomized complate block design was followed for the experiment. BARI halud-1 was used as the test crop. From the results of the experiment, it was found that among the treatments as expected F3= 50% STB (N65P25K70S10Zn2) +5 (ton cowdung/ha) is the highest yield of termaric in the both year (22.01 t/ha and 22.11 t/ha) with the highest BCR (10.67 and 10.72) and lowest yield (8.00 t/ha, 8.01t/ha) with BCR (3.65 and 3.65) was obtained when the plants raised with control treatment.

1. To find out the optimum rates of fertilizers and manures for higher yield of turmeric.

The Experiment was conducted at farmer’s field in Sherpur district under Regional Agricultural Research station, Bangladesh Agricultural Research Institute (BARI), Jamalpur, during Kharif season from April 2008 to February, 2009 and April 2009 to February 2010. The initial soil samples collected from a depth of 0-15 cm were analyzed by ASI method (Hunter, 1984) and the properties are presented in Table 1. The unit plot size was 2.0m X 2.0m and spacing maintained for Termaric 50cm apart with plant to plant distance 25 cm. The treatments comprising of F1 = (control), F2 = (Soil test base: N130P40K130S15Zn2 kg/ha), F3 = (50% STB + 10 ton cowdung/ha), F4 = (FRG -2005: N120P30K100S15Zn3 kg/ha + 3 ton cowdung/ha), F5 = (75% FRG-2005+5 ton cowdung/ha), F6 = (10 ton cowdung/ha) and F7 = (Farmer’s practice: N50P20K40+5 ton cowdung/ha) were the experiment laid out in randomized block design with three replications. Full dose of cowdung, PKS and Zn were applied at final land preparation and half of N dose was applied at 50 days after planting. Remaining N were applied in two equal splits at 80 and 110 days after planting. Rhizomes (BARI halud-1) were planted 12 April, 2008 and 2009. Different intercultural operations such as pest and disease management, weeding, irrigation, earthing up etc. were done as and when necessary. Rhizomes were harvested 10 February, 2009 and 2010 when plant showed symptoms to leaf drying and lodged on the soil. Data on plant height, No. of plant/hill, No. of leaves/plant, No. of primary finger/hill, rhizome wt/plot and rhizome yield t/ha were recorded from randomly selected 10 plants of each treatment. The data were analyzed statistically and means were separated to find out difference among the treatments.The Recorded data were compiled and analyzed statistically and means were separated by Duncan’s Multiple Range Test (DMRT) . To find out the difference among the treatments benefit cost ratio (BCR) of different treatments were also calculated.

The highest yield was obtained from the turmeric grown with NPK followed by NK , because the plants with these treatments remained green longer and they had higher shoot biomass, which ultimately contributed to higher yield. The highest BCR (10.72) was obtained from F3 = 50%, STB + 5t CD/ha treated plot followed by F4 = FRG-2005: N120P40K120S15Zn3 (8.60), F5 = 75% FRG-2005+5 t CD/ha(8.28), F7 = Farmer’s practice: N60P30K60+ 5 t CD(8.07), F6 = 10 t CD/ha(7.75), F2 = Soil test base (STB): N130P40K130S15Zn2 (7.38) and lowest was (3.65) obtained from control treated plot F1. From two years study, it can be concluded that 50% STB+5t CD /ha i.e N65P25K70S10Zn2 kg/ha +5 t cowdung/ha is the suitable combination of fertilizers and manure for higher yield and economically profitable.
